1. What is Perforated Metal?

Perforated metal is a material with holes punched into it. These holes can be of various sizes and shapes. This unique design makes it lightweight yet strong. Because of its versatility, perforated metal is used in many industries. One important area is marine applications.

2. Why Use Perforated Metal in Marine Settings?

Marine environments can be tough. There’s saltwater, high humidity, and strong winds. Perforated metal is perfect for these conditions. Its design reduces weight without sacrificing strength. It helps in preventing rust and corrosion too. So, it becomes a reliable choice for boats and ships.

3. Common Uses in Marine Applications

Perforated metal has many uses in marine applications. Here are some of the most common:
  • Decking: Perforated metal is often used for walkways and decks. It provides slip resistance and is easy to clean.
  • Fencing: For security and safety, perforated metal makes effective fencing. It allows visibility and ventilation.
  • Grilles and Screens: These materials protect from debris while allowing air and light to pass through.
  • Structural Components: From brackets to supports, perforated metal can be used in various structural components.

4. Benefits of Using Perforated Metal in Marine Applications

Choosing perforated metal in marine settings comes with many benefits:
  • Lightweight: This metal type is much lighter than solid sheets.
  • Durability: Its sturdy construction offers long-lasting performance.
  • Corrosion Resistance: Special coatings can be applied to resist rust.
  • Customizable: It can be tailored to fit specific needs.

6. Easy to Install

Another advantage is how easy it is to install. Many marine applications involve customization. Perforated metal can be cut to specific shapes. It is simple to work with, making the installation process quick.
